The "New Mini" first appeared in North American showrooms as a 2002 model, as part of the turn-of-the-century wave of retro-styled machinery that included the Volkswagen New Beetle , Chrysler PT Cruiser and Chevrolet HHR. Chrysler Group LLC reported total US sales for July 2009 of 88,900 units, a decrease of 9% year-on-year, although up 30% versus June 2009.
